Intranet
Engineering Systems and Computing Major

Engineering Systems and Computing

Why Study Engineering Systems and Computing at U of G?

The growing field of Engineering systems and Computing fuses computer science with electrical engineering to design modern solutions for the technological industry. You’ll focus on the science and tools behind designing, constructing, implementing and maintaining software and hardware components of modern computing systems in your career and studies.

 Design, Implement and Develop Solutions

Develop computer systems that are crucial to everything from aircraft to the human body. Explore a unique mix of software development, computing hardware design, fluid mechanics and thermodynamics, control and modelling.

 Choose Your Area of Focus

Choose from elective concentrations in the areas of control systems, biomedical, robotics, mechatronics, embedded systems, internet of things, software-hardware systems, and human-centered computing. In upper years, choose one or more streams: mechatronics, robotics, embedded systems, biomedical, or computing – then pursue a career to match!

 Take a One-of-a-kind Program

Engineering Systems and Computing at the University of Guelph is the only program of its kind in Canada that focuses on designing integrated, computer-based engineering systems.

To see all courses offered in the Engineering Systems and Computing program, visit our Academic Calendar.

Gain Valuable Experience Through Co-op

Our Engineering Systems and Computing co-op is a five-year program, with five work terms, designed to facilitate the transition of students from academic studies to a professional career improving students’ job search skills, work performance and networking abilities, and boosting resume experience. Learn more about the Engineering Systems and Computing Co-op program.

Careers in Engineering Systems and Computing

In this program, you’ll gain valuable hands-on experience and develop skills in problem-solving, project management, leadership, and communication. You'll also work on interdisciplinary projects that emphasize collaboration, teamwork, and design. These abilities will prepare you for success in a variety of exciting fields, including:

  • Government
  • Environment
  • Research and Development
  • Manufacturing
  • Healthcare
  • Technology
  • Energy
  • Transportation
  • Construction
  • Product Development
  • Communications
  • Cybersecurity
  • Entertainment
  • Consulting
  • Education and Research

Careers you can pursue with a B.Eng. degree in Engineering Systems and Computing:

  • Systems Engineer
  • Software Systems Analyst
  • AI/ML Engineer
  • Project Manager
  • Automation Engineer
  • Information Systems Manager
  • Control Systems Engineer
  • Robotics Engineer
schulich leader scholarships logo

Canada’s Most Coveted Scholarships

Apply now for the Schulich Leader Scholarships — Canada’s top STEM scholarship: get up to $120,000 over four years. Nomination deadline is January 28, 2026, so don’t wait — talk to your school rep today!

Portrait of Ayesha Mahmood
The engineering community at Guelph was truly unmatched. Paired with the Engineering Systems & Computing program standing as the sole program in Canada specializing in integrated computer-based engineering systems. Its curriculum covering software development, hardware design, mechanics, signal processing, and optimization control aligned with my ambition to grasp the complexities and practical application of technological engineering.

Ayesha Mahmood, Undergraduate Student
Engineering Systems & Computing

Portrait of Maksim Stroikin
I chose Engineering Systems and Computing at Guelph because it's one of the few programs in Canada focused on designing computer-engineering systems, which when combined with Guelph's unique hands-on learning approach makes this program truly unique. What I like most about my program is that it gave me a strong foundation in programming, electrical system design, and hardware control while still giving me the freedom to pursue the areas I enjoy most through extensive technical elective offering. Taking courses such as Design I & II, Object-Oriented Programming and Digital System Design has really taught me how to effectively work in multidisciplinary teams and provided me with the necessary skills to secure a Co-op work term as part of my Co-op program. As such, I was able to gain relevant industry experience before I even graduated.

Maksim Stroikin, Undergraduate Student
Engineering Systems and Computing

Discover More Options

Students considering Engineering Systems and Computing may also be interested in Biological Engineering, Computer Engineering, Mechanical Engineering, or other majors.

Admission Requirements

Explore admission requirements for Canadian, international, transfer, and mature students. Start your journey today!

View Admission Requirements

Scholarships & Bursaries

We offer a wide range of financial aid programs to assist with funding your education at the University of Guelph.

Explore Scholarships & Financial Aid

Tour Our Campus

Through virtual tours, presentations, webinars and in-person tours, get familiar with the University of Guelph campus.

Book a Tour

Have Questions?

Learn more about how to connect, discover, and engage with programs, facilities and life at the University of Guelph.

Request More Info

Sign Up to Learn More

Loading...

Choose U of Guelph

APPLY NOW